Nigeria See Off Algeria to Book AFCON 2025 Semifinal Spot
Nigeria delivered when it mattered most. Two second-half strikes were enough to silence Algeria and keep the title dream alive.
Nigeria Set the Tone Early

From the opening whistle in Marrakech, Nigeria made their intentions clear: high tempo, aggressive pressing and physical dominance. The Super Eagles controlled much of the first half, pinning Algeria deep and creating a steady stream of chances.
Victor Osimhen went close with an early header that flew over the bar, while Ademola Lookman and Alex Iwobi consistently found space out wide. Despite Nigeria’s control, the breakthrough did not arrive before the interval, thanks to resilient Algerian defending and a couple of sharp saves from Luca Zidane.
Osimhen Breaks the Deadlock
The second half could not have started better for Nigeria. Less than two minutes after the restart, Calvin Bassey delivered a perfectly weighted cross from the left that found Osimhen, who rose above his marker and powered a header down past Zidane.
The opener felt inevitable. Nigeria’s intensity and belief finally translated onto the scoreboard in the Africa Cup of Nations 2025 quarterfinal.
Akor Adams Delivers the Knockout Blow
Algeria barely had time to regroup. Ten minutes later, Osimhen turned provider, sliding a precise pass into the path of Akor Adams. The forward burst through the defense and finished clinically to make it 2-0.
From that moment on, Nigeria were firmly in control, while Algeria struggled to respond, overwhelmed physically and tactically.
Zidane Prevents a Heavier Scoreline
The margin could have been wider. Luca Zidane produced several important stops, including a low drive from Lookman and a close-range effort that kept the score respectable.
Even the presence of Zinedine Zidane in the stands was not enough to inspire a turnaround on a night that belonged to the Super Eagles.
Nigeria March On With Authority
With this win, Nigeria advance to the semifinals of the AFCON 2025, reinforcing their status as genuine title contenders. Driven by Osimhen’s leadership, solid at the back and ruthless when it mattered, the Super Eagles sent a clear message to the rest of the tournament.
Algeria exit with frustration and unanswered questions. Nigeria, meanwhile, remain firmly on course and one step closer to continental glory.
